High Security Locks
Standard locks don’t last long in Middle River’s salt-air environment. The persistent humidity off the river accelerates corrosion of exposed brass and zinc components, shortening functional lifespans and creating security gaps. We install and service Medeco, Mul-T-Lock, and Abloy high-security cylinders that resist picking, drilling, and unauthorized key duplication. For waterfront commercial properties, we specify marine-grade stainless steel hardware that withstands the ambient conditions that destroy standard residential-grade products in two to three years.

Panic Bar Installation & Repair
Salt-air corrosion seizes commercial panic bar mechanisms on waterfront warehouse exits throughout Middle River, particularly after winter freeze-thaw cycles. A sticking panic bar isn’t just an operational headache; it’s a code compliance issue. We replace fatigued springs and corroded cylinders, and when retrofit is the smarter play, we install new panic bar systems with weather-resistant components. Installation typically runs $400-$650; repair of existing hardware runs $180-$340.

Common Commercial Locksmith Problems We See in Middle River
- Salt-air corrosion seizes panic bar mechanisms on waterfront warehouse exits. The combination of ambient humidity and salt-laden air attacks internal springs and cylinders, causing binding or complete failure. We replace with weather-resistant components spec’d for marine environments.
- Decade-old Schlage or Yale deadbolts on aging commercial retail doors snap keys in early spring freeze-thaw cycles. Corroded cylinders weakened over winter fail suddenly when temperatures fluctuate. We extract broken keys and evaluate whether the lock can be salvaged or needs replacement.
- Dock-box locker locks corrode over winter, with shackles freezing solid. Seasonal boaters return to Middle River marinas each spring to find padlocks that won’t open. We drill out seized hardware and install marine-grade replacements before the boating season gets underway.
- Master key systems on multi-unit commercial properties lose integrity through unauthorized duplication. We rekey to restricted keyways and install high-security cylinders that cannot be copied at corner hardware stores.
Pricing for Commercial Locksmith in Middle River, MD
We’re transparent about what commercial locksmith work costs in Middle River because we’ve seen what bait-and-switch pricing does to business owners who’ve already had a bad experience.
| Service | Typical Range in Middle River |
|---|---|
| Commercial lockout | $150 - $250 |
| Lock rekey (per cylinder) | $25 - $45 |
| High-security lock installation | $280 - $520 |
| Panic bar repair | $180 - $340 |
| Panic bar installation (new) | $400 - $650 |
| Master key system (small commercial) | $350 - $850 |
| Marine-grade padlock replacement | $85 - $180 |
Factors that move the needle: marine-grade hardware costs more than standard equivalents but lasts three to four times longer in Middle River’s environment; older doors with shifted frames may need strike plate adjustment or jamb repair; restricted keyway systems add upfront cost but eliminate unauthorized duplication.
